Transaction 62623d09dc2d31109511f9d5cc7dda367331a4a7ef938422a3b4043dc3ba873f

1 Input
2 Outputs
  • 62623d09dc2d31109511f9d5cc7dda367331a4a7ef938422a3b4043dc3ba873f:0
  • value  128520
    address  2NFhFyVP91asHechsy8wKYUSKjvMrQfmUrf
  • 62623d09dc2d31109511f9d5cc7dda367331a4a7ef938422a3b4043dc3ba873f:1
  • value  4277971878
    address  2N8gaoF3KXDbi2E9tBi1S5V3xZZw4FNXHi2